SQLite 数据库浏览器与安卓
在本文中,我们将介绍如何使用SQLite数据库浏览器与安卓应用程序进行数据库操作。SQLite是一种轻型嵌入式数据库引擎,常用于移动应用开发中。它具有快速、可靠和易于使用的特点,是安卓应用程序中常用的数据库选择之一。
阅读更多:SQLite 教程
什么是SQLite?
SQLite是一种自给自足的嵌入式数据库引擎,并且在大多数标准操作系统上都可以运行。它没有独立的服务器进程,数据存储在应用程序的本地文件中。这种数据库引擎遵循ACID(原子性、一致性、隔离性和持久性)原则,可以保证数据的完整性和稳定性。
SQLite数据库非常轻量级,它的库文件很小,占用内存较少。这使得SQLite非常适合移动设备,特别是安卓应用程序开发。许多安卓应用程序都使用SQLite作为其本地数据库。
安卓中使用SQLite
在安卓中使用SQLite,首先需要创建一个SQLite数据库。可以使用SQLiteOpenHelper类来管理数据库的创建和版本控制。下面是一个简单的示例:
上面的代码创建了一个名为”mydatabase.db”的数据库,并在其中创建了一个名为”mytable”的表。在onUpgrade方法中,可以定义数据库升级的逻辑。
数据库操作
在安卓中,可以使用SQLiteDatabase类执行对SQLite数据库的各种操作,包括插入、查询、更新和删除数据。下面是一些示例代码:
- 插入数据:
- 查询数据:
- 更新数据:
- 删除数据:
SQLite数据库浏览器
为了更方便地管理和查看SQLite数据库中的数据,我们可以使用SQLite数据库浏览器。有很多开源和商业的SQLite数据库浏览器可供选择,例如DB Browser for SQLite、SQLiteStudio等。
这些数据库浏览器提供了直观友好的界面,可以轻松浏览和编辑数据库表、执行SQL查询、导入和导出数据等。通过SQLite数据库浏览器,我们可以更高效地进行数据库操作和调试。
总结
在本文中,我们介绍了SQLite数据库以及在安卓中使用SQLite的基本方法。SQLite作为一种轻量级嵌入式数据库引擎,非常适合安卓应用程序开发。我们还了解了如何使用SQLiteOpenHelper来管理数据库的创建和版本控制,以及如何进行各种数据库操作。最后,我们介绍了SQLite数据库浏览器的作用和使用。
通过学习和使用SQLite,我们可以更好地管理和操作安卓应用程序中的数据库,提高开发效率和数据管理能力。希望本文对你有所帮助!